I used to work at the Vale View in the 80's too! It is a crying shame what's happened to it - I think there's some kind of insurance dispute that's holding up the repairs. But the longer they wait the worse state the place will be in.

Its difficult to imagine the place even approaching its former glory without Mahon O'Brian. Men like him are not common in this world...

Can anyone tell me what has become of the Vale View Hotel? I used to work there back in the 80's. I know there was a fire some years ago, but it has never re-opened. Anyone know of any plans to do anything with it ? Is it for sale ? Mahon O'Brien would turn in his grave if he could see the place now.

I first came to Avoca with my Mum as she is a big fan of Ballykissangel. But I now come back every 6 months because it is the beautiful village I fell in Love with. I go to the same places every time but never tire of them. You all have such a beautiful village and of course I have to give Riggs, the local dog a cuddle! The Handweavers serves gorgeous food as does Fitzgeralds. The Meetings is one of my favourite places, early on a Sunday moring when you have it all to yourself! I can understand the residents would like it to be known for it's own merits other than Ballyk, but believe me when I say how lucky you are to live is such a place, and can wake up to that beauty every day. I'm only young myself, so can see me coming back for many years to come. Thankyou you all for your hospitality.
